Top Ten Games of 2023
Planet Of Lana. Excellent 2D platform adventure game
Deathloop. Surprising addition to my top ten as it was a game I played on Game Pass. It is a clever game and getting the good ending and breaking the loop feels earned and is satisfying
Hardspace Shipbreaker. For a game involving work and also space ships, it’s such a simple pleasure to correctly dismantle and dispose of a ship. I really liked the story as well.
Cocoon. My brain is still having a hard time figuring out the mechanics towards the end of Cocoon, the fact that it all works so well and it’s hard to get lost only makes this more impressive.
Vampire Survivors. At first I dismissed this as a bullet shooter but the more I played, the more I appreciated the depth and variety.
The Murder Of Sonic The Hedgehog. What was announced as an April Fools joke is a surprisingly decent mystery adventure game.
The Great Ace Attorney. It took my years to get through both of Ace Attorneys games but what a journey it was.
Good Life. For what was meant to be a casual club game. This just completely hooked me. It was so corny but it completely charmed me. Goddamn hellhole.
Pikmin 4. So much more to this then previous games but every addition feels worthwhile
Zelda Tears Of The Kingdom. Struggled to get into this at first when I realized it was the same Hyrule as the first game, but the more I played, the more I saw how the new mechanics made everything so new and frest.
